Output e8ff8676f39766656d5f0081ca29ba3d91ef69c1ecdb6385aaeef3ff06393eb5:2

value
12602081
script pubkey
OP_0 OP_PUSHBYTES_20 ca33a3e40aa3b18dfc43df32dab099d58acc4fa6
address
bc1qege68eq25wccmlzrmued4vye6k9vcnaxt5zuhe
transaction
e8ff8676f39766656d5f0081ca29ba3d91ef69c1ecdb6385aaeef3ff06393eb5
spent
true